我想自己写前端的代码,但是又不想覆盖已有的资源,assetManager这里我要怎么写呢?

来源:3-1 前台首页的页面搭建

no4990

2017-04-12

http://szimg.mukewang.com/58ed85db0001354010010409.jpg

老师提供的模板代码中引用资源是这样子引用的,不输入全地址就能找到资源,那么我现在在web下创建了一个assets2的文件夹,放我自己写的页面的css、图片那些,我该如何去配置呢?

http://szimg.mukewang.com/58ed85b40001d35206480535.jpg

我想和saaetManager的设置有关,但是不清楚要怎样修改,希望各位能指点一下,非常感谢!

还是说我只能将我的资源和老师的合并到一个文件夹中?

-----------------------------------------------------------------------------------------------------------------

【2017-04-12更新】

解决方法:

在老师的建议下,我将assetManager的basePath改成了__DIR__.'/../web'

然后资源引用的话,写成src="assets2/images/要引用的资源名"

这样就可以使用自己的文件夹下的资源了。

-----------------------------------------------------------------------------------------------------------------

谢谢各位,如果有更好的方法也希望能提出来交流一下。

写回答

1回答

Jason

2017-04-12

你可以定义到web,也就是现在的上级路径,这样在模板里面可以改为assets和assets2,不定死在assets就可以

1
2
no4990
非常感谢!
2017-04-12
共2条回复

Yii2.0开发一个仿京东商城平台

【毕设】购物、下单、支付、收货...各功能模块开发,打造京东式电商平台

1543 学习 · 655 问题

查看课程